Monaco:
Fifth seeds Mahesh Bhupathi and Max Mirnyi made their second consecutive ATP Masters Series final after beating Simon Aspelin and Paul Hanley in straight sets in Monte Carlo here on Saturday.
The Indo-Belarusian combo saw off the challenge of the seventh seeds 6-3, 7-6(3) in the semi-finals of the euro 254,3750 clay court event.
They will take on top seeds Daniel Nestor of Canada and Nenand Zimonjic of Serbia in the summit clash.
Last month Bhupathi and Mirnyi had lost the title clash of the Miami event to Leander Paes and Lukas Dlouhy.
